Valdespino is one of the oldest bodegas in Jerez. In 1264, Alfonso Valdespino was one of 24 knights who fought against the Arabs for the city of Jerez with King Alfonso X. As a reward for his efforts, he was given the land that formed the basis of the bodega. Deliciosa is very dry, crisp and fresh with a slightly saline finish. -

Ripe apple aromas and notes of brioche. The palate has orchard fruit characters, bright acidity, and a persistent mousse. The traditional Cava grapes of Macabeo, Parellada and Xarel-lo are sourced from a single vineyard. Winemaking follows the traditional method with second fermentation in bottle. The wine ages on lees, in the bottle, for 12-15 months before release. -
